Ok, I've played FM's before, but it has been a while. Did a system re-install becasue of a HDD failure and, of course, re-installed my Thief games (Thief Gold, Thief 2, & Thief 3.) Set up my fan missions, and decided to play some of them while I was at it. Only, "crash" went the game. It doesn't even get to the main menu, just dark screen followed by "Thief: The Dark Project has encountered an error and needs to close." What is boggling my mind is, as long as I'm playing the main game itself, it works just fine. Videos work, audio works (except one minor problem, I remember having but don't remember how/if I fixed it, still looking, more below,) every single mission works. Downlaoded a new FM, and same problem. Turned off HW acceleration on video. Downgraded video drivers as far as I could. Turned of HW acceleration on audio. Tried installing in different directories, even the default directory. Even installed a No-CD patch to see if that had any effect. I installed Dromed (though I usually just install the convict.osm, schemas, & scripts I downloaded.) Re-downloaded the FMs. Set the compatablility mode to 95 & 98 (which kept the game from loading into original missions, & FM's still crashed before the menu.) I've checked ownership & access to the game directory (and all daughter objects.) I'm out of things to try. And, yes, I didabled all but one CPU to the exe files.
Running WinXP pro SP3, ATI Radeon HD4650, Soundblaster X-Fi Extreme, Dual Core 2.4 Ghz, 2G RAM.

Pheonix on 13/1/2012 at 07:45
Ok, got it fixed, but the method was strange (to me at least.)
In my searches, came across instructions to "Move all crf files to the RES directory" in order to prepare the install for FMs. When I did that, it started crashing. So, looking at the resname_base line in install.cfg I added \RES to the C:\Games\ThiefG entry. It still crashed, so I almost decided to stop there. On a hunch, I changed it to include BOTH C:\Games\ThiefG "and" C:\Games\ThiefG\RES and it started loading just fine again. Now, all the FMs load just fine as well :)
